BATON ROUGE, La. (AP) - The neighbor of a Baton police officer has been accused of breaking into the officer’s home through a shared balcony and stealing her gun.

The Advocate (https://bit.ly/2nZ6b8Q) reports 25-year-old Marcus Johnson was arrested Wednesday and charged with aggravated burglary.

The officer told investigators she came home to find a picture on the ground and her blinds askew last October. She later noticed her back-up weapon was missing from her purse.



She told detectives that she had issues before with Johnson, with whom she shared a balcony. She also said the lock on her balcony window didn’t work.

Documents show Johnson’s girlfriend told the officer she saw Johnson with the handgun.

It’s unclear if he has an attorney.
